This table covers the complete CV axle shafts from differential (or hub) to wheel. Typical signs include a click in tight turns, grease flung around the wheel well, or a vibration that builds with speed. A torn boot caught early is a boot kit; caught late it is the whole axle. Torque the axle nut to the method in the notes.

Buying Drivetrain Parts for a 2022 BMW X7
On this vehicle, the drivetrain system moves power from transmission to wheels through axles, CV joints, driveshafts, differentials and wheel-end hardware.
- Match the engine first. Some drivetrain parts fit every engine; others are engine-specific. Each row shows which engine(s) it fits.
- Read the notes on each row for position, trim and spec qualifiers before you order.
- Where labor overlaps, replace the differential or transfer-case fluid with any axle or seal job while everything is already open.
- Cross-reference the manufacturer part number against your old part or a service-manual listing.

What are the signs of drivetrain problems on a 2022 BMW X7?
Common symptoms include clicking in tight turns, a clunk when shifting between drive and reverse, vibration that builds with speed, or gear oil on the inside of a wheel. If you notice any of these, identify the affected subcategory above and cross-reference the part numbers listed.
